Atlassian and Cenqua The Software Dealers


Atlassian acquired Cenqua, a dealer of software engineering tools like the Fisheye and Crucible on the August 1 of 2007. Atlassian and Cenqua were the two fastest emerging developers of software development tools. A more widespread, compiled experience for software developers will be the main center of focus by the combined company.

Atlassian provides issue tracking and incessant compilation tools and cenqua gives the insight, review and quality analysis to the codes and soft wares.

Atlassian develops reasonably priced, non-bulky software that helps the enterprises to pool the resources in a better way in coordination with the companies it acquired, Cenqua and Authentisoft being two of them. There are more than 7,500 consumers in over 90 nations, with many of the companies. Clover, Fisheye and Crucible will remain separate products, and will retain the same development team.
